spaghettify

English dictionary entry

Meanings

verb
  1. To stretch an object into a long thin shape under the influence of a very strong gravitational field gradient, such as found near a black hole.

Word forms

spaghettify spaghettifies spaghettifying spaghettified

Etymology

Back-formation from spaghettification, equivalent to spaghetti + -fy.
